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12247830358 36 382215 887758251 0266
49588 822338
49588 822338
172101 48395 913049214
All about undefined
Interested in learning more?
49588 822338
172101 48395 913049214
See more
861295715 17524
956 46900 63980037310
See more
359928099 1060022746
1028665 85944524 616 86184172
See more